Answer:

mean absolute deviation would be 2.75

Step-by-step explanation:

mean: 4 + 2 + 2 + 10 = 18/4 = 4.5

4.5 - 4 = 0.5

4.5 - 2 = 2.5

4.5 - 2 = 2.5

4.5 - 10 = 5.5

mean absolute deviation: 0.5 + 2.5 + 2.5 + 5.5 = 11/4 = 2.75
